Abstract
The invention discloses a portable solar lawn lamp comprising a lamp holder and a solar cell holder. The lamp holder and the solar cell holder are connected vertically to form a base, the surface of the lamp holder is provided with a plurality of LED lamp bodies, and the surface of the solar cell holder is provided with a plurality of solar cell panels. One portable lawn lamp is formed by the base, a support rod, a top cap and a lampshade which only need to be combined together in use. The portable solar lawn lamp can be detached for carrying and transportation, thereby being low in transportation cost and simple in structure; the lampshade is made of composite cloth, so that the lawn lamp is lightweight and portable; insect expelling solution is sprayed on the composite cloth, so that photokinetic insects are avoided getting close to the lawn lamp; various patterns can be printed on a printing layer of the composite cloth, thus the lawn lamp is more attractive; the portable solar lawn lamp can also be applied to indoor-outdoor and advertising lighting and applied as celling lamps, hood downlight, outdoor lamps, photoflood lamps, stage lamps and the like, is low in manufacturing cost and has great market prospect.

Detailed description of the invention
Below in conjunction with the accompanying drawing in the embodiment of the present invention, be clearly and completely described the technical scheme in the embodiment of the present invention, obviously, described embodiment is only the present invention's part embodiment, instead of whole embodiments.Based on the embodiment in the present invention, those of ordinary skill in the art, not making the every other embodiment obtained under creative work prerequisite, belong to the scope of protection of the invention.
Refer to Fig. 1 ~ 4, in the embodiment of the present invention, a kind of portable type solar energy Green ground lamp, comprise lamp socket 2 and solar-electricity stall 9, described lamp socket 2 connects and composes a base with solar-electricity stall about 9, wherein the surface of lamp socket 2 is provided with several LED 7, the surface of solar-electricity stall 9 is provided with some pieces of solar panels 12, evening lamp socket 2 upward, by solar panel 12 for the LED 7 on lamp socket 2 provides electric energy, solar-electricity stall 9 is placed towards the sun by daytime, charges to solar panel 12; The surface of described lamp socket 2 is provided with reflecting piece 8;
Described lamp socket 2 is provided with installing hole 10 with the center of solar-electricity stall 9, be provided with four pieces of fan-shaped blocks 11 at the inwall of installing hole 10 and form X-shaped mounting groove, support bar 5 is inserted with in X-shaped mounting groove in described installing hole 10, the cross sectional shape of support bar 5 is X, coordinating with X-shaped mounting groove to prevent lamp socket 2 from rotating, described support bar 5 is provided with rectangular block 3 simultaneously, is limited the position of base by rectangular block 3;
One end of described support bar 5 is tip 1, the other end of support bar 5 connects top cap 6, described top cap 6 adopts well-illuminated plastic material, do not affect the irradiation of light, be provided with lampshade 4 between described top cap 6 and base, lampshade 4 is Compound Fabric, described Compound Fabric is made up of watertight composition 13, cotton layer 14 and printed layers 15, wherein watertight composition 13 adopts the elastomeric material of 400-700 micron thickness, and the thickness of cotton layer 14 is 2-3 millimeter, and printed layers 15 adopts woven dacron or paper;
The concrete preparation method of described Compound Fabric is: by placement smooth for clean cotton layer 14 on the table, spraying equipment is adopted to uniformly spray in the one side of cotton layer 14 by the rubber base-material of melting, after cooling, sticking double faced adhesive tape is used to live woven dacron at the another side of cotton layer 14.Due to woven dacron smooth surface, be convenient to printing, woven dacron can be removed and clean simultaneously.
The using method of described lampshade 4 is be sprayed at by insect repellant solution in Compound Fabric, utilizes cotton layer 1 to absorb insect repellant solution, in use insect repellant solution volatilizing from lampshade 4 slowly, thus the insect avoiding light is close.
Operation principle of the present invention is: utilize base, support bar 5, top cap 6 and lampshade 4 to form a portable Green ground lamp, only need during use to combine, the present invention simultaneously can take apart and carry and transport, and cost of transportation is low, structure is simple, and the lampshade 4 of this practicality utilizes Compound Fabric, lightweight, be easy to carry, insect repellant solution can be sprayed in Compound Fabric simultaneously, thus the insect avoiding light is close, the printed layers 15 of described Compound Fabric can print various pattern, more attractive in appearance; Technology of the present invention can also apply to indoor and outdoor and advertising lighting, pendent lamp, cover lamp, outdoor lamp, the aspect such as photography luminaire and stage lighting, and assembly and disassembly is convenient, and low cost of manufacture is practical, good decorative property.
